Chrome Tremolite Vs Sarcopside Fracture

Fracture is an important parameter when you compare Chrome Tremolite and Sarcopside Physical Properties. It is necessary to understand the significance of these properties, before you compare Chrome Tremolite Vs Sarcopside fracture. Whenever a gemstone chip breaks, it leaves a characteristic line along its breakage. Such lines are known as fracture and are used to identify the gemstones in their initial stages of production when they are in the form of rough minerals. Fracture is usually described with the terms “fibrous” and “splintery” to denote a fracture that usually leaves elongated and sharp edges. Sarcopside fracture is Lamellar and Splintery.
